Typical Safari Days
You are privately guided in an open-sided game viewing vehicle (the vehicle in the picture in this mail), your game drives are exceptional in that your guide is able to interpret the behaviour, the ecology and relationships of and between all the animals, vegetation and landscapes you see during your game drives with him. His accreditations and qualifications as a field guide and trails ranger are exemplary, and coupled with 15 years of experience in the Kruger make your time with him a once-in-a-lifetime experience.

Big 5 sightings of elephant, rhino, lion, leopard and African buffalo are just as rewarding as all the aspects of being in the African bush in amongst the 148 mammal species, over 500 birds, 350 tree species and a huge diversity of landscapes and eco-zones. It’s our ability to interpret this amazing diversity of wildlife, of cultural and historical influences, as well as unravel the ecological secrets and mysteries that make Africa so special that makes us leaders in private guiding in the Kruger National Park.

Kruger nights are wonderful - the southern skies play host to the nocturnal calls of hyenas, jackals, baboons and lion all while you enjoy once-in-a-lifetime moments in the African bush.

Two game drives every day - no schedule for the length or diversity of the game drives except your needs, and what the bush delivers.

On one your nights with us we organise a nocturnal drive (night drive) with spotlights – in order to get out in the dark which presents wonderful opportunities to look at the glorious star-filled skies, and some of the more secretive animals like wild cats, porcupines, owls, African civet and other nocturnal animals.

Accommodation on your full service safari

A private bushveld lodge ideally situated in the central Kruger NP. Our drives and activities include several dams, open savanna and thorn thickets with some amazing riverbeds and pools to explore. Elephants, lion and buffalo are prolific in this area as well as the endangered cheetah.

An ideal lodge positioned to photograph the wildlife in open savanna, and often includes remarkable sights of hunting predators, large herds of buffalo and elephants aggregating around water holes.

Your accommodation consists of either a two bedroom en-suite chalet, or a one bedroom en-suite chalet. They are fully serviced, with full bathrooms and an outside patio - all under beautiful thatched roofs and very comfortable. All our guests enjoy private en-suite accommodation.

Meals on your full service safari

Your guide is accompanied by his hospitality chef on safari who spends his day preparing your meals, ensuring that all beverages, table settings and mood fires are lit, cooked and ready to present the other important part of a successful safari – your meals. Together they make an exceptional team providing guiding and hospitality service that is unmatched in South Africa.

Meals include an early morning breakfast (before your first game drive)

A full breakfast (after your first game drive)

A light lunch

Dinner – mostly cooked outdoors, over an open fire

(All local beer, South African wine, bottled water and fresh juice is provided and included in your quoted price on this full service itinerary)

Nothing is too much trouble on this safari – and we start preparing menus long before your trip is set to start. We carefully plan all meals to ensure that you get to eat the type of food that you enjoy.

Game viewing is almost always dependent on what’s happening in the bush.

A pride of lions on a kill, or watching buffalo interaction, or elephants, even simply exploring the diversity of this great wildlife reserve, means that we are well aware that mealtimes must be dynamic. So we always keep snacks and cold drinks on board in the vehicle, just in case.
